I can't help with first hand experience because my pcs are both now W10.64. I had an old generic bluetooth adapter which I don't normally use, but just plugged it in and it has happily connected to a 'phone - so there's nothing wrong in W10, and I don't really see why 7 would be substantially different.

Have you only just started trying the bt devices or did they ever work properly (except for yesterday)? Are you using Belkin's driver or Microsoft's; and have you tried deleting one or the other and trying again? I'd guess that you have..

Have you tried plugging the adapters in through a usb hub? I have a couple of MS keyboard/mouse sets that won't work properly with the transceiver plugged directly to the pc, but are fine when in a hub.
